FATV - Brazil 1 - England 0 (14th November 2009 - Qatar)
A 47th-minute header from Nilmar gave Brazil a 1-0 victory over England in Qatar.
The forward ghosted in between Wes Brown and Matthew Upson to direct Elano's cross beyond Ben Foster in the England goal. The advantage might have been doubled just minutes later when Nilmar was felled by Foster inside the area, but Luis Fabiano's penalty was too high and it sailed over the bar.
In his 57th game Wayne Rooney captained his country for the first time.
Brazil: Julio Cesar, Maicon, Lucio, Thiago Silva, Michel Bastos, Felipe Melo, Silva, Elano, Kaka, Nilmar, Luis Fabiano. Subs: Doni, Lucas, Dani Alves, Aurelio, Alex, Luisao, Josue, Carlos Eduardo, Naldo, Hulk, Julio Baptista.
England: Foster, Brown, Upson, Lescott, Bridge, Wright-Phillips, Barry, Jenas, Milner, Rooney, Bent. Subs: Green, Cahill, Warnock, Huddlestone, Crouch, Defoe, Young, Hart.
